Output b89f4b154592fe6b0053fe11ca9d2c79eb87fa4a45496ad2090468d25f0618ba:0

value
32706436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e93fcac6e04d83a29da24e47e902e2aa55b3a75 OP_EQUAL
address
3G9VyAqVKLFReLfcv651QeJGGB5sfv37pH
transaction
b89f4b154592fe6b0053fe11ca9d2c79eb87fa4a45496ad2090468d25f0618ba
confirmations
520885
spent
true